Wetlines ban passes transportation
committee, moves to full House
 

Members of the House of Representatives Transportation and Infrastructure Committee approved a bill November 19 to ban wetlines (exposed retained product piping) on cargo tank trailers used to transport Class 3 flammable liquids. The bill (HR 4016) still must be approved by the full House and must be passed by the Senate...

Trimac completes purchase
of StarTrans business, assets
 

Trimac Dry Bulk Group Inc has completed the purchase of the business and certain assets of StarTrans Inc. A South Carolina-based motor carrier, StarTrans is engaged in the transportation of dry bulk products, including cement and lime products, and operates in a 20-state area east of the Mississippi River through a network of nine terminals in eight states...
